WHO YOU’LL WORK WITH
You will be part of the Supply Chain & Planning Technology (SCPT) Engineering team in the sub-domain of Supply, Sourcing & Manufacturing (SSM), leading leading the development of Nike’s Supply & Materials Planning, Finished Goods & Materials Costing & Sourcing, Factory Floor Systems, Product Integrity, Direct Procurement and Suppier Collaboration platforms and experiences at Nike's India Technology Center (ITC). You will report to the Senior Director of Technology SCPT-SSM and partner directly with local and global Business Operations, Technology Product and Engineering leadership lead, support and develop team members, manage priorities and create results across boundaries. You will also collaborate closely with SCPT central function leaders (Program Operations, Business Operations & Enablement, Quality Engineering, Site Reliability Engineering) and counterparts across Supply Chain & Planning Ops and Technology teams based in the US (PHK) and SE Asia (with the Central Hub in Singapore but spread across multiple countries).
WHO WE ARE LOOKING FOR
We are looking for an experienced Director of Engineering to join our team in Bengaluru, India to establish our engineering and product presence in ITC from the existing small footprint into a fully-formed organization which can build and deliver our product roadmaps in for SSM jointly with our PHK and Singapore based teams. The right person is a strong people leader who can develop talent in ITC, a thoughtful operator who knows how to stand up new teams and build credible partnership with our technology and operations partners. This role will help us set the right culture for our new team in ITC and help us evolve the ways of working to embed our ITC team with our existing presence in US and SE Asia. They bring high EQ, comfort operating across cultural and time zone boundaries, and the maturity to lead people within a matrix org.
The Director of Engineering will lead, support and develop team members, manage priorities and create results across boundaries. The successful candidate is an inclusive and empowering leader with a history of enabling agile teams to solve technical problems in a product model, including building scalable platforms, strong data foundations, and user applications.
Key Qualifications:
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, Engineering, or related field or equivalent experience.
Extensive experience leading Engineering Managers and large engineering organizations.
Deep expertise in global supply chain applications and enterprise resource planning systems.
Proven success delivering enterprise-scale, production software systems in complex business environments.
Strong background in serverless architectures and cloud platforms (Microsoft Azure and Amazon Web Services)
Proven DevOps experience — continuous integration and continuous delivery, GitHub, and managing distributed applications.
Proficiency across modern and legacy technologies, including Java/React/Node.js,/Visual Basic/.Net and RESTful application programming interfaces.
Experience with data platforms and stores — Databricks, NoSQL (Azure Cosmos DB), Amazon Simple Storage Service, and relational databases (PostgreSQL and MySQL)
Familiarity with monitoring tools such as Amazon CloudWatch and Azure Application Insights.
Experience building or leading artificial intelligence and machine learning-driven supply chain applications.
Ability to guide teams on responsible use of artificial intelligence-assisted development tools such as Cursor and GitHub Copilot.
Strong systems thinking across cloud, data, DevOps, and agile delivery environments.
Executive-level communication and stakeholder influence skills.
WHAT YOU’LL WORK ON
This role will lead engineering teams delivering critical supply , sourcing and manufacturing platforms, partnering with business leaders to shape priorities and tradeoffs, while owning delivery, reliability, and architecture, improve our data foundation, driving DevOps and AI/ML adoption, and ensuring scalable, high-quality solutions across global teams.
Your responsibilities include:
Lead Engineering Managers, Principal Engineers, and senior technical leaders across multiple teams delivering critical supply and manufacturing platforms.
Partner with product and business leaders to shape requirements, priorities, and tradeoffs — not only execute a roadmap handed to engineering.
Setup and lead a technology delivery organization which rapidly innovates and delivers business value at speed and scale.
Own delivery, reliability, and evolution of mission-critical platforms, including enterprise resource planning and global supply chain applications.
Drive architectural alignment and engineering excellence across cloud, serverless, data, and application teams.
Establish strong DevOps practices — continuous integration and continuous delivery, GitHub workflows, and disciplined production support and escalation models.
Lead artificial intelligence and machine learning initiatives that improve supply chain planning, execution, and decision-making.
Oversee vendor and extended team worker delivery with the same quality, tracking, and knowledge-transfer expectations as full-time employee teams.
Build effective leadership and delivery rhythm across United States and India sites.
Serve as incident lead for high-severity production incidents — coordinate technical leads, communicate with stakeholders, authorize remediation, and confirm business resolution.
Inspect and improve delivery, reliability, cost, observability, and team health metrics with your leadership team.
